A restaurant chain with a café in Sheffield is offering a special menu for Pancake Day - and this is our verdict

Shrove Tuesday is upon us – and many restaurants are giving diners the chance to avoid creating a floury mess in the kitchen by offering special pancake menus.

Bill’s, the national chain founded by greengrocer Bill Collison 20 years ago, is serving savoury and sweet options from February 25 until March 1, alongside a list of bespoke cocktails to match, at its café bar in Sheffield near the Peace Gardens.

We tried the sweetcorn pancakes with poached eggs, feta, avocado, baby spinach, red pepper dressing, coriander and chilli. This was a substantial, spicy dish that would be ideal for brunch – it also puts a fresh spin on the idea of pancakes full stop, proving they can be dressed up in all manner of ways.

Not that the dessert options at Bill's aren't tempting. The sweet pancakes with frozen berries and white chocolate sauce arrived topped with sharp-tasting fruits, while the chocolate was provided in a small sauce boat – this wasn’t overly sweet, and closely resembled vanilla custard.

The portions are large though, and while it would be perfectly feasible to order both a sweet and savoury course, it’s probably wisest to choose just one.

Roast tomato and black olive vegan pancakes, and a plate piled with caramelised banana and salted caramel ice cream, are featured on the menu alongside a relatively no-frills variety simply served with lemon and sugar.

Of our two cocktails, the Bill's Collins – vodka, rhubarb liqueur, raspberry syrup and lime juice – had the edge over Hedgerow Fizz, a smaller drink consisting of elderflower cordial topped with prosecco and a single raspberry.

Sweet pancakes are priced £5.95, savoury pancakes cost either £8.95 or £9.95, and children's dishes are priced at £3.50 – so if anyone is intent on observing Lent, this is an affordable indulgent feast before Easter.

And maybe it’ll convince British eaters that pancakes aren’t just for Shrove Tuesday.

Bill’s, 2 Paul's Place, 127 Norfolk Street, Sheffield, S1 2JF. Visit www.bills-website.co.uk or call 0114 272 3342 for details. The pancake menu is identical at all Bill’s restaurants.
